When it comes to kidney health, knowing the normal range for creatinine clearance is like having a GPS for your renal function—it keeps you on track! Typically, a healthy kidney filters creatinine, a waste product produced by muscle metabolism, at a rate of 70 to 120 mL/min. Now, here’s the thing: while some might say the normal range goes up to 85-150 mL/min, this broader range can be misleading. The accepted standard leans towards that 70 to 120 mL/min threshold. Why? Well, it aligns with the majority of clinical assessments across various labs. Always remember, though, that the specifics can vary depending on the laboratory and the methods they use.

So, what does it mean if a patient's creatinine clearance is outside this range? For starters, it might indicate a decline in kidney function. If it dips too low, you’re looking at potential renal failure or other serious complications.
